
Agricultural Innovation Systems
This self-learning course focuses on Agricultural Innovation Systems (AIS), providing participants with the knowledge and skills necessary to understand and implement innovative practices and technologies that drive productivity and sustainability in agriculture. Participants will explore how innovation systems—comprising research, development, policies, and market connections—can enhance agricultural productivity, improve food security, and foster sustainable farming practices. The course covers key topics such as agricultural research and extension systems, the role of technology in agriculture, and the importance of multi-stakeholder collaboration in promoting agricultural innovations.
